[RBW] Fender Brands (Besides SKS) That Work On A Sam

2017-09-16 Thread tc
Hey everyone,
I'm interested to know what brands of fenders (besides SKS) you've 
successfully installed on a 700c Sam with Tektro R559 long reach brakes & 
Alex DM18 rims that come with the 'Complete' build.

I just spent the better part of today trying to install some 700c X 50 
Berthoud stainless steel fenders, but gave up because of front fender 
fitment issues ... didn't even get to the back.

The issues for me:

   - The fender curvature is too open/flat, pushing up against the 
   non-drive side brake arm, which forces that brake arm closed.  So, hat shoe 
   very slightly brushes the rim, with brakes open wide.  
   I did try to squeeze the fender sides together, but was not able to do 
   much good, and was scared of crimping them (I'd already slightly crimped 
   the back of the fender when testing the stay length, so didn't want to 
   force the issue).
   
   - The daruma bolt fender attachment point under the fork crown positions 
   the fender too high, again pushing the fender up against the underside of 
   the non-drive side brake arm.  If the fender wasn't already so close to the 
   tire I could've added another rubber washer on top of the fender to 
   effectively lower it.
   
   - The daruma bolt shipped with the fenders is very long ... too long.  
   Not wanting the end of the bolt dangling too close to the tire, I use a 
   bolt cutter to chop it to size, and ended up fowling the threads such that 
   I couldn't get the nut to screw on, no matter how much I filed and tried to 
   re-thread it.


So, looking for another brand of fender.  I prefer to keep the brakes, 
rims, and tires I have.  If I have to go with the SKS longboards I will, 
but I much prefer the look and sturdiness of metal fenders.  I hope someone 
has had success!
